Ventilation Solutions: Turbine Ventilators vs. Traditional Fans
Determining the optimal ventilation solution for your building requires careful evaluation of various factors. Two popular choices are turbine ventilators and traditional fans, each offering distinct benefits. Turbine ventilators utilize mechanical airflow driven by wind power, providing continuous ventilation without the need for power. They are particularly effective in well-ventilated areas with consistent wind speeds. Traditional fans, on the other hand, depend electrical power to move air within a space. While they offer greater control over airflow direction and speed, they consume electricity. Choosing between these two options depends on your individual needs, budget constraints, and environmental conditions.
